Product Description: Tyrphostin A48 is primarily used as a selective inhibitor of protein tyrosine kinases, making it a valuable tool in biochemical and cellular research. It is applied in studies involving signal transduction pathways, particularly those related to cell growth, differentiation, and oncogenesis. Researchers use Tyrphostin A48 to probe the role of tyrosine phosphorylation in various disease models, especially cancer, where abnormal kinase activity contributes to tumor progression. It has also been employed in investigating inflammatory responses and immune cell regulation due to its ability to modulate kinase-dependent signaling events. Its selectivity allows for targeted intervention in experimental settings, helping to elucidate the function of specific kinases without broadly disrupting cellular enzyme activity.
